Principle of Metal Detector Machine & Anti-interference Solution For High-Salt Wet Food Products
Many factory purchasers only know metal detectors can find metal contaminants, but rarely understand its core working principle. Especially for high-moisture & high-salt products like pickles, sauces and aquatic cooked food, unstable sensitivity and frequent false alarms always puzzle production teams, leading to bad equipment selection and reduced line efficiency.
The core working principle of a metal detector relies on electromagnetic induction technology: The detection head generates a stable invisible alternating electromagnetic field continuously. When metal contaminants such as iron, stainless steel, copper and aluminum pass through the field, eddy current will be induced inside metal objects. The eddy current will reversely interfere the original electromagnetic field. The control board captures tiny changes of electromagnetic signals accurately, then identifies metal foreign matters and triggers alarm alerts, which is the basic logic of conventional metal detectors.
However, real production lines face a common problem: high-water and high-salt materials like seasonings, preserved food and fresh aquatic products have weak electrical conductivity. They will also interfere electromagnetic signals when passing through the detection area, generating similar signal changes as tiny metal fragments. Basic low-end detectors cannot distinguish signal disturbance from products and real metal impurities, resulting in massive unnecessary false alarms and frequent line shutdowns.
Our self-developed industrial metal detector adopts optimized algorithm structure and exclusive adaptive material signal compensation technology. It can record baseline interference signals of specific products in advance, filter out signal fluctuations brought by high-moisture & high-salt food automatically, and identify tiny metal impurities accurately. It maintains high detection sensitivity while greatly reducing false alarms, perfectly matching production lines for pickled food, sauces, braised food and aquatic prepared dishes.
Customizable compensation parameters support quick setup for dry snacks, raw materials, daily chemical packages and pharmaceutical solid preparations without hardware modification. The built-in multi-dimensional signal verification module eliminates external electromagnetic interference from workshop motors and inverters, ensuring stable detection precision during 24-hour continuous operation.
Understanding metal detector principle and anti-interference solutions helps factories avoid selection mistakes: basic models only fit dry low-interference products, while professional detectors with material signal compensation are necessary for high-salt & wet food processing. Proper model matching helps factories block metal risks to avoid product recalls, and prevents line downtime caused by false alarms to maximize equipment value.
